3. Job Set-up
Subtask 32-11-16-941-052-A
A. Safety Precautions
   (1) As necessary, use the applicable SAFETY BARRIERS, specified by the operator's instructions and your local regulations.
   (2) Make sure that the ground safety locks are installed on the landing gear (Ref. AMM TASK 32-00-00-481-001).
   (3) Put a WARNING NOTICE(S) on the ground service connection to tell persons not to pressurize:
  • The Green hydraulic system
  • The Yellow hydraulic system.
   (4) On panel 400VU:
  • Make sure that the landing-gear control-lever 6GA is in the DOWN position
  • Put a WARNING NOTICE(S) in position to tell persons not to operate the landing gear.
Subtask 32-11-16-860-052-A
B. Aircraft Maintenance Configuration
   (1) Disconnect the isolation coupling of the power transfer unit (Ref. AMM TASK 29-23-00-860-001).
   (2) Make sure that the Green and Yellow hydraulic systems are depressurized
(Ref. AMM TASK 29-00-00-864-001).
   (3) Depressurize the applicable hydraulic reservoir (Ref. AMM TASK 29-14-00-614-001).
Subtask 32-11-16-582-050-A
C. Lift the Aircraft
   (1) Lift the aircraft on jacks (Ref. AMM TASK 07-11-00-581-001).
Subtask 32-11-16-869-054-A
D. Flight Configuration Precautions
   (1) If the electrical power is not necessary for other maintenance tasks, de-energize the aircraft electrical circuits (Ref. AMM TASK 24-41-00-862-002). Then, it is not necessary to operate the LGCIU circuit breakers.
   (2) If the electrical power is necessary, do the precautions for flight configuration (Ref. AMM TASK 32-00-00-860-001) before you open the LGCIU circuit breakers.

Subtask 32-11-16-010-052-B
F. Get Access
   (1) Put the ACCESS PLATFORM 3M (10 FT)- ADJUSTABLE in position at zone 731 (741).
   (2) Put the ACCESS PLATFORM 3M (10 FT)- ADJUSTABLE in position below zone 571 (671).
   (3) Remove the cover plates (65) and (66) as follows:
WARNING: USE PROTECTIVE GOGGLES WHEN YOU REMOVE OR INSTALL A COTTER PIN. EACH TIME YOU REMOVE A COTTER PIN DURING THE TASK, DISCARD IT IMMEDIATELY. A LOOSE COTTER PIN CAN CUT YOU OR MAKE YOU BLIND.
     (a) Remove and discard the cotter pins (71) and (72).
     (b) Remove the nuts (69) and (70), the bridge plates (67) and (68) and the cover plates (65) and (66).
4. Procedure
Subtask 32-11-16-020-052-C ** ON A/C NOT FOR ALL
A. Removal of the MLG Side-Stay Assembly
WARNING: USE PROTECTIVE GOGGLES AND GLOVES WHEN YOU REMOVE OR INSTALL LOCKWIRE. EACH TIME YOU CUT LOCKWIRE, REMOVE AND DISCARD IT IMMEDIATELY. LOOSE LOCKWIRE CAN CUT YOU OR MAKE YOU BLIND, AND/OR CAN CAUSE DAMAGE.
   (1) Disconnect the electrical connector of the cable (8) from the proximity sensor (2).
   (2) Remove the bolts (12), the washers (11) and the clips (10) from the bracket (9).
   (3) Put the CAP-BLANKING on each disconnected electrical connector and receptacle.
   (4) Disconnect the hydraulic hoses (37) and (38) as follows:
WARNING: DO NOT GET THE FLUID ON YOUR SKIN OR IN YOUR EYES. IF YOU DO:
  • FLUSH IT AWAY WITH CLEAN WATER
  • GET MEDICAL AID.
CAUTION: MAKE SURE THAT THE FLUID DOES NOT STAY ON THE AIRCRAFT STRUCTURE. IF THE FLUID GETS ON THE AIRCRAFT STRUCTURE, WASH IT OFF IMMEDIATELY WITH SOAP AND WATER.
     (a) Put the CONTAINER 1 L (1/4 USGAL) below the hose unions (32) and (43) and the hoses (37) and (38).
     (b) Disconnect the hose unions (32) and (43) from the hoses (37) and (38).
     (c) Cut, remove and discard the lockwire from the nuts (39), (42), (36) and (33).
     (d) Remove the nuts (33) and (42) and the washers (34) and (41).
     (e) Remove the hoses (37) and (38) from the bracket assembly.
     (f) Remove the washers (35) and (40) from the hoses (37) and (38).
     (g) Put the PLUG-BLANKING in each disconnected line end.
   (5) Disconnect the locksprings at their top attachment (Ref. AMM TASK 32-11-19-000-003).
   (6) Install the 98D32104013004 SPLINT ASSEMBLY - SIDE STAY on the side-stay assembly (3) with:
  • The cables to the side-stay splint assembly
  • The strap to the side-stay splint assembly
  • The center joint of the side-stay located in the center hole of the side-stay splint assembly.
   (7) Tighten the strap and connect the cables to the hook.
   (8) Remove the cotter pin (15), the nut (14) and the washer (16). Discard the cotter pin (15).
   (9) Hold the lockstay (17) (which weighs 3.4 kg (7.50 lb)) and remove the pin (19) and the washer (18).
   (10) Carefully disengage the lockstay (17) from the cardan joint and collect the spacers (13).
   (11) Compress the lockstay actuator to fold the lockstay and safety the lockstay in this position.
   (12) Remove and discard the cotter pin (24).
   (13) Remove the nut (25), the washer (26), the bolt (20) and the end caps (21) and (23).
   (14) Use the 460006440 EXTRACTOR to remove the pin (22).
   (15) Disconnect the lower cardan sub-assembly from the lower side-stay assembly (3) and remove the washers (44).
   (16) Remove and discard the lockwire from the bolt (27).
   (17) Remove the bolt (27) and the washer (28).
   (18) Remove the lock washer (29) from the nut (30).
NOTE: It is recommended to use the plastic tools to remove the washer (28) and the lock washer (29) to prevent damage.
   (19) Use the 460007272 SPANNER-TUBE and remove the nut (30) from the cardan pin (31).
   (20) Remove the cardan pin (31) from the MLG leg assy.
   (21) Loosely engage the cardan pin (31) to the lower side-stay (3) with:
  • The washers (44)
  • The pin (22)
  • The end caps (21) and (23)
  • The bolt (20)
  • The washer (26)
  • The nut (25).
     (a) Do not install the cotter pin (24).
   (22) Make sure that all the related parts are clean before you remove the circlip (7). Remove the circlip (7) as follows:
     (a) Use an applicable tool to release the tail of the circlip (7) from the key slot of the lock washer (6).
     (b) Hold the tail of the circlip (7) with a pair of PLIERS - CIRCLIP.
     (c) Carefully pull the circlip (7) in a clockwise direction until it releases from the chamfered slot in the nut (5).
   (23) Remove the lock washer (6) from the nut (5).
   (24) Use the 460005812 SPANNER - TUBE or the 460007271 SPANNER-TUBE and remove the nut (5), and the washer (4) from the cardan pin (1).
NOTE: It is recommended to use the plastic tools to remove the washer (4) and the lock washer (6) to prevent damage.
   (25) Move the side-stay until the cardan pin (1) comes out of the side-stay bracket. Tighten the strap to prevent movement of the side-stay assembly (3).
WARNING: BE CAREFUL WHEN YOU REMOVE OR INSTALL THE MLG SIDE-STAY. IT WEIGHS 62.5kg (137.5lb).
     (a) Lower the side-stay assembly (3) on to a TRESTLE - PADDED and remove the cables from the hook.
   (26) If it is necessary to replace the side-stay assembly (3), then remove the side-stay splint assembly.
   (27) Remove the seal (54) from the bush (53). Discard the seal (54).
